What Affects Residential & Commercial Pest Control Costs in Nash?
Understanding pricing factors helps you budget accurately and avoid surprises
labor costs
In small towns like Nash in Bowie County, labor rates for certified exterminators are often more affordable than in big Texas cities like Dallas or Houston. Experience and licensing add to the cost but ensure quality work.
market dynamics
Nash's proximity to wooded areas and humid climate means steady demand for pest services, keeping prices competitive. Limited local providers during outbreaks can push rates up.
seasonal trends
Peak summer demand for mosquitoes, ants, and roaches often increases prices due to high call volume. Termite activity stays consistent year-round, with inspections more common in spring.
🧱 Key Pricing Components
- ✓ - Inspection and pest ID: Initial visit to assess the issue.
- ✓ - Treatment method and materials: Sprays, baits, or fumigation—varies by pest.
- ✓ - Property size and access: Larger commercial spaces or hard-to-reach areas cost more.
- ✓ - Frequency of service: One-time vs. ongoing quarterly plans.
- ✓ - Regulatory compliance: Extra for commercial properties with health codes.

Pricing Red Flags
Warning Sign
Unusually low quotes: May indicate unlicensed work or ineffective treatments.
Warning Sign
Hidden fees: Watch for surprise charges for materials or follow-ups.
Warning Sign
High-pressure tactics: 'Act now or infestation worsens'—take time to compare.
Warning Sign
No license proof: Texas requires certification; always verify.
Warning Sign
Verbal-only deals: Insist on written contracts.
Pricing Questions
Common questions about residential & commercial pest control costs in Nash
💬 What factors most affect pest control costs in Nash?
Key drivers include pest type (termites cost more than ants), property size, and treatment intensity. Commercial sites often pay more due to scale and regulations.
💬 Are there cheaper options for residential vs. commercial pest control?
Residential services typically cost less per visit. Commercial needs broader coverage and compliance, raising the total.
Ongoing plans can even out costs for both.
💬 How do seasonal trends impact pricing?
Summer peaks in Nash mean higher demand and potentially elevated rates. Off-season bookings can save money for non-urgent issues.
💬 What's included in a standard pest control quote?
Usually covers inspection, initial treatment, and follow-up. Ask if re-treatments or guarantees are included at no extra cost.
💬 Do I need a contract for pest control services?
One-time treatments often don't require one, but maintenance plans do. Review terms for cancellation and guarantees carefully.
💬 How can I verify a pest control pro is legit in Texas?
Check for Texas Department of Agriculture license. Reputable ones carry insurance and offer written warranties.
